Human Trafficking and Sexual Assault

Human trafficking involves the use of force, fraud, or coercion to obtain some type of labor or commercial sex act. Every year, millions of men, women, and children are trafficked worldwide – including right here in the United States. It can happen in any community and victims can be any age, race, gender, or nationality. Join Sherwood Library and the FCPD to learn what you need to know regarding Human Trafficking in your community.
